| /* |
| * motion_comp.h |
| * Copyright (C) 2000-2003 Michel Lespinasse <walken@zoy.org> |
| * Copyright (C) 1999-2000 Aaron Holtzman <aholtzma@ess.engr.uvic.ca> |
| * |
| * This file is part of mpeg2dec, a free MPEG-2 video stream decoder. |
| * See http://libmpeg2.sourceforge.net/ for updates. |
| * |

| #define avg2(a,b) ((a+b+1)>>1) |
| #define avg4(a,b,c,d) ((a+b+c+d+2)>>2) |
| |
| #define predict_o(i) (ref[i]) |
| #define predict_x(i) (avg2 (ref[i], ref[i+1])) |
| #define predict_y(i) (avg2 (ref[i], (ref+stride)[i])) |
| #define predict_xy(i) (avg4 (ref[i], ref[i+1], \ |
| (ref+stride)[i], (ref+stride)[i+1])) |
| |
| #define put(predictor,i) dest[i] = predictor (i) |
| #define avg(predictor,i) dest[i] = avg2 (predictor (i), dest[i]) |
| |
| /* mc function template */ |
| #define MC_FUNC(op, xy) \ |
| MC_FUNC_16(op, xy) \ |
| MC_FUNC_8(op, xy) |
| |
| #define MC_FUNC_16(op, xy) \ |
| void MC_##op##_##xy##_16 (uint8_t * dest, const uint8_t * ref, \ |
| const int stride, int height) \ |
| { \ |
| do { \ |
| op (predict_##xy, 0); \ |
| op (predict_##xy, 1); \ |
| op (predict_##xy, 2); \ |
| op (predict_##xy, 3); \ |
| op (predict_##xy, 4); \ |
| op (predict_##xy, 5); \ |
| op (predict_##xy, 6); \ |
| op (predict_##xy, 7); \ |
| op (predict_##xy, 8); \ |
| op (predict_##xy, 9); \ |
| op (predict_##xy, 10); \ |
| op (predict_##xy, 11); \ |
| op (predict_##xy, 12); \ |
| op (predict_##xy, 13); \ |
| op (predict_##xy, 14); \ |
| op (predict_##xy, 15); \ |
| ref += stride; \ |
| dest += stride; \ |
| } while (--height); \ |
| } |
| |
| #define MC_FUNC_8(op, xy) \ |
| void MC_##op##_##xy##_8 (uint8_t * dest, const uint8_t * ref, \ |
| const int stride, int height) \ |
| { \ |
| do { \ |
| op (predict_##xy, 0); \ |
| op (predict_##xy, 1); \ |
| op (predict_##xy, 2); \ |
| op (predict_##xy, 3); \ |
| op (predict_##xy, 4); \ |
| op (predict_##xy, 5); \ |
| op (predict_##xy, 6); \ |
| op (predict_##xy, 7); \ |
| ref += stride; \ |
| dest += stride; \ |
| } while (--height); \ |
| } |
